Rei Wakana, known on stage by the performance name LAYER, is a central character in the BanG Dream! franchise, primarily associated with the band RAISE A SUILEN. She is a young woman of striking appearance, characterized by her tall, lean frame, pale skin, and sharp, intelligent eyes that are typically a cool gray-blue. Her natural hair is a long, straight black, but she is almost always seen with a distinctive, voluminous purple and blue ombre extension that cascades down her back, matching her stage persona. Her fashion sense is edgy and urban, favoring dark, layered streetwear, leather jackets, and silver accessories, which reflect her cool and collected exterior.
Born to a Japanese father and an American mother, Rei grew up in a bilingual and bicultural household, which has given her a native-level command of both Japanese and English. This background has also influenced her worldview, making her comfortable in diverse settings but also contributing to a sense of being an observer, someone who often stands slightly apart from the groups around her. Her upbringing was heavily influenced by her mother, a professional bassist who was her first and most profound musical inspiration. Rei’s early life was steeped in music, learning bass guitar from her mother and developing an eclectic taste that spans rock, funk, jazz, and electronic music. This deep, almost scholarly understanding of music forms the bedrock of her identity.
In terms of personality, Rei Wakana is the quintessential cool, calm, and collected figure. She is stoic, level-headed, and rarely displays strong emotions, preferring to process events through logic and observation. This demeanor can initially come across as distant or intimidating, but it is not born of arrogance. Rather, it is a combination of natural introversion and a deeply ingrained focus on her craft. She is a perfectionist, holding herself to incredibly high standards and approaching her bass playing and songwriting with a meticulous, analytical mindset. Beneath this serene surface, however, lies a passionate and driven individual. Her passion is not loud but intense, a quiet fire that fuels her dedication to music and her bandmates. She is fiercely loyal, though she expresses this loyalty through actions rather than words, offering steadfast support and practical solutions rather than emotional comfort. She is also surprisingly playful in her own dry, subtle way, often delivering deadpan observations or teasing her friends with a straight face, revealing a witty and observant nature.
Rei’s primary motivation is musical excellence and authenticity. She is driven by a desire to create music that is technically brilliant and emotionally true, a goal inherited from her mother’s legacy. She is not interested in fame or superficial success; her core drive is the pursuit of a sound that feels genuine and powerful. This motivation leads her to seek out fellow musicians who share her seriousness and ambition. She is also motivated by a quiet need to connect, to find a place where she belongs. Having often felt like an outsider due to her bilingual background and intense focus on music, the formation of RAISE A SUILEN provides her with a found family where her unique talents and intense dedication are not just accepted but essential.
Her role in the story is primarily as the bassist, leader, and chief composer of RAISE A SUILEN. She is the musical and strategic anchor of the group. While the band is officially led by their DJ, Chiyu Tamade, Rei is the undeniable musical director, responsible for arranging their complex, genre-blending songs and guiding the band’s artistic vision. She is the one who translates the group’s raw energy and emotions into structured, powerful compositions. Her role is often that of a silent pillar; she doesn't seek the spotlight, but her presence is foundational, providing the rhythmic and harmonic stability upon which the band’s explosive sound is built. In the larger narrative of BanG Dream!, she represents a more mature and technically focused counterpoint to the more emotionally driven and beginner-friendly bands, showcasing a different path to success in the music industry—one built on years of discipline and formal knowledge.
Key relationships define much of her development. Her partnership with Chiyu Tamade is central and complex. Chiyu, the passionate and sometimes chaotic leader, provides the emotional heart and raw vision for the band, while Rei provides the structure and technical means to realize it. Their dynamic is one of creative friction and deep mutual respect; they clash over methods but are united by an unshakeable belief in each other’s abilities. Rei’s relationship with her guitarist, Rokka Asahi, is another crucial one. Rokka is a natural talent but lacks Rei’s formal training and experience. Rei takes on a mentorship role, patiently guiding Rokka and helping her refine her skills, a process that also forces Rei to become more communicative and patient. Her bond with the band’s drummer, Masuki Satou, and keyboardist, Reona Nyubara, is built on mutual respect and a shared love for their instruments, creating a tight-knit musical unit that understands each other without needing many words.
Rei Wakana undergoes significant development over the course of the story. She begins as a solitary, self-reliant musician who believes that her path is a solitary pursuit of perfection. Through her experiences with RAISE A SUILEN, she learns the value of collaboration and trust. She gradually opens up, allowing herself to be vulnerable and to rely on others. She learns that musical perfection is not the only goal; that the messy, human connections and shared emotions within a band are what give music its true power. This development is subtle but profound, as she moves from being a detached, almost clinical musician to a dedicated and emotionally invested leader who fights not just for the music, but for the people who create it with her.
Her notable abilities are extensive and directly tied to her background. She is an exceptionally skilled bassist, with a technical proficiency that is among the highest in the franchise. Her playing is characterized by its precision, groove, and complexity, seamlessly blending intricate fingerstyle techniques with a deep, resonant tone. She is also a gifted arranger and composer, capable of crafting songs that incorporate diverse genres like EDM, rock, and hip-hop into a cohesive and powerful whole. Her musical ear is legendary within the story; she can instantly identify a wrong note or a timing issue and articulate exactly how to fix it. Her bilingual fluency is another practical ability, allowing her to connect with the international music scene and incorporate English lyrics seamlessly into her songs, giving RAISE A SUILEN a unique, cosmopolitan edge. Ultimately, her greatest ability is her unwavering dedication and the quiet, magnetic force she exerts, drawing talented individuals together and compelling them to reach for the highest level of musical expression.
